The story of James Allison Downing began in 1898 in Rantoul, Champaign, Illinois, USA. In 1910, James Allison Downing resided in Rantoul, Champaign, Illinois, USA. In 1917, James Allison Downing resided in Fulton County, Illinois, USA. James Allison Downing married Nellie Ann Huckaby, and had children including Betty Jane Downing, Edgar Downing, Jessie Downing, Jimmy Downing, Lester Downing, Martin Downing. James Allison Downing passed away in 1980 in Rantoul, Champaign, Illinois, USA.
